Aaron Altherr Crashes Into Wall, Leaves Game Early
Aaron Altherr (knee, toe) left the game early on Monday with a right big toe sprain and a bruised right knee after crashing into the outfield wall. Altherr was hitless with two strikeouts in his two plate appearances before departing the contest. He has had a brutal season, hitting just .181/.295/.333 with eight home runs and 38 RBI in 104 games. With the regular season finale on Sunday, there's a chance that Altherr's 2018 season is over.
